Elliott List wins Player of the Year Award 2020/21

13 May 2021

Forward Elliott List has been awarded Stevenage FC Player of the Year 2020/21...

With a career high goal tally of eleven, Elliott List's performances this season have earned him the title of Stevenage FC Player of the Year 2020/21.

Having fought off close competition in Terence Vancooten, who himself had a season to remember, List adds the award to his three GCIS UK Player of the Month victories across the season. 

"I am absolutely buzzing to win the award", List said. "I have won a few Player of the Months, and this just tops off a great season. Since January we have had a really good turnaround, and this just tops off a lot of hard work. I just want to say thank you to everyone who voted.

It has been my most enjoyable season, most goals I have scored, played the most games I have ever played. It had been a great season, especially after the last one. I feel like we have put pride back into the team, back into the Club."

Since January, Elliott List has often been paired up top with ex-Gillingham strike partner Luke Norris. "Luke is a great lad, I have known him for quite a while now. I am always trying to learn from him, learn around him. He is a great player and has a good footballing mind. He is a pleasure to work with everyday.

The turnaround has been brilliant. If the season started in January, we would have been in the play-offs. That is just the way it is, but it looks good for next season".
